Population in Comoros compared to Poland: Trends, Charts, Rankings

Updated on by Georank team

The latest officially reported population of Comoros was 866,628 in 2024 vs 36,559,233 people in Poland in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Comoros' population is 903,776 people compared to 35,806,942 in Poland.

Population statistics:

  • Poland's population is 39.6 times bigger than Comoros'.
  • Comoros is ranked the 160th most populous country in the world, while Poland is the 47th.
  • The countries together account for 0.44% of the world: 0.01% for Comoros vs 0.43% for Poland.
  • For the last 10 years, Comoros has had an average growth rate of +2.01% per year vs -0.36% in Poland.
  • Since 2006, the population of Comoros has increased from 605K people to 904K (49.4% growth), while Poland has declined from 38.1M to 35.8M (6.12% decline).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Comoros increased by 136,988 people (a 22.7% growth), while Poland lost 171,180 people (a 0.45% decline).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Comoros gained 162,035 people (a 21.8% growth), while Poland's population decreased by 2,163,145 people (a 5.7% decline).

Comoros was ranked 163rd most populous country in 2006 and is 160th in 2026. Poland was ranked 32nd in 2006 and ranked 47th now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Comoros' population will grow by 45.1% to 1,311,253 people with a rank change from 160th to 157th. The population of Poland will decrease by 13.1% to 31,107,894 people and rank change from 47th to 62nd.

Comoros is projected to reach its peak in 2100 at 1.93M people, while Poland's population already peaked in 1998 at 38.7M people and is projected to decrease to 18.4M people by 2100.

Over the last 10 years, 87.9% of the population change in Comoros is from natural causes (a gain of 179,319 people) and 12.1% is from migration (a loss of 24,709 people). In Poland 41.4% is from natural causes (a loss of 675,443 people) and 58.6% is from migration (a gain of 955,766 people).

As of 2024, 12,449 residents or 1.4% of the population were not native-born in Comoros, compared to 1,739,901 people or 4.5% in Poland.
